When a thirteen-year-old boy is bullied at school, he discovers an ability to turn "invisible." An emotional and compelling portrayal of bullying and mental health, perfect for fans of RJ Palacio's Wonder.
"...I decided to find a new power, one so great they wouldn't be able to hurt me at all. And I finally found it."
"Which power was that?"
"I have the power to make myself invisible."
A boy wakes up in a hospital room with no memory of how he got there.
As time passes, the pieces of what happened that fateful day start falling into place, and the boy remembers his secret: he has the power to become invisible.
But the boy is hesitant to tell anyone the truth. What will they think of him if they find out the reason he gained this ability? And what if it makes everything worse?
Told in alternating perspectives following the boy, his friends, his parents, his teacher, as well as his bully, the events of that day are slowly revealed through flashbacks. A heart wrenching and powerful read for anyone who has ever felt "invisible."
